Iris and B. Gerald Cantor Art Gallery Presents "Call and Response"

WORCESTER, Mass. – The Iris and B. Gerald Cantor Art Gallery at the College of the Holy Cross presents Call and Response, from Monday, Sept. 15 through Saturday, Oct. 11, 2003.

Call and Response includes four extraordinary bodies of work that question the notion of the isolated artist and showcases arenas of shared artistic production. This exhibition presents the dynamic relationship inherent in shared ideas, images and dreams, and includes artists of international stature as well as artists just emerging on the art scene.

An exhibition catalogue, written by Barbara O'Brien with other contributors, will be published in conjunction with the show. Formerly, Barbara O'Brien was the director of the Gallery and Visiting Artist Program at Montserrat College of Art in Beverly, Mass. Over the past 20 years, she has curated numerous exhibitions throughout New England.
